דף הבית » איך ל » כיצד להפוך את המחשב הביתה אובונטו לתוך שרת אינטרנט LAMP

    כיצד להפוך את המחשב הביתה אובונטו לתוך שרת אינטרנט LAMP

    יש לך מחשב לינוקס אתה רוצה לשים לעבודה? אולי אתה לא מרגיש בנוח עם שורת הפקודה רק גירסה של Ubuntu Server Edition. הנה איך לשמור על שולחן העבודה סטנדרטי אובונטו ולהוסיף אינטרנט יכולות המשרתים אותו.

    בין אם אתה לא נוח עם מערכת שורת פקודה בלבד, אתה משתמש בשולחן העבודה של אובונטו עבור דברים אחרים, או שאתה פשוט צריך את זה מותקן עבור כמה יישומים מסוימים, אתה יכול להוסיף Apache, MySQL ו- PHP לכל שולחן עבודה רגיל התקנה של אובונטו במהירות ובקלות.

    הפיקוד הפשוט

    בואו נתחיל עם השימוש בפקודה חכמה מאוד:

    sudo apt-get להתקין מנורת שרת ^

    זה לא יעבוד בלי הקארט בסוף. ברגע שיש לך את זה נכנס, תראה כי זה בוחר באופן אוטומטי את כל החבילות הדרושים יבקש ממך לאשר את כמות "גדול" של נתונים כדי להוריד.

    רק לשבת מאחור ולתת לו לעשות את הדבר עד שאתה מקבל מסך כחול צצים.

    הזן סיסמה עבור חשבון root של MySQL, וזה מה שאתה צריך כדי ליצור משתמשים אחרים ולנהל מסדי נתונים, ולאחר מכן הקש על Enter כדי להמשיך. תתבקש להזין מחדש את הסיסמה שלך, כדי לעשות זאת ולהכות שוב ב- Enter.

    זהו זה עבור ההתקנה!

    בדיקת אפאצ 'י ו PHP

    בואו נבדוק את אפאצ 'י כדי לראות אם הוא פועל כהלכה. פתח דפדפן ופנה אליו את כתובת האתר הבאה:

    http: // localhost /

    אתה אמור לראות משהו כזה מופיע אם הכל מותקן כראוי:

    הבא, נבדוק אם PHP עובד. במסוף, הזן את הפקודה הבאה כדי ליצור מסמך חדש:

    sudo nano /var/www/testing.php

    לאחר מכן, העתק את הקוד הבא:

    לחץ לחיצה ימנית על המסוף שלך ולחץ על הדבק.

    הכה CTRL + O כדי "לכתוב את" או לשמור את הקובץ, ולאחר מכן פגע CTRL + X כדי לצאת.

    לאחר מכן, הפעל מחדש את Apache באמצעות הפקודה הבאה:

    שירות - -

    וטען את הדף הבא בדפדפן האינטרנט שלך:

    http: //localhost/testing.php

    ואתה צריך לראות משהו כזה:

    בדיקת כתובת MySQL Bind

    MySQL יש כתובת לאגד כי צריך להתאים את המערכת שלך. כדי לבדוק את כתובת הקישור של המערכת שלך, אנו יכולים להשתמש בפקודה מהירה:

    חתול / etc / hosts | grep localhost - -

    זה "צינור" או "גזע" באמצע, אשר משותף עם \ מפתח. תקבל כמה תוצאות, שאחת מהן תציג לך כתובת IP.

    אתה יכול לראות מ צילום מסך לעיל כי כתובת לאגד שלי הוא 127.0.0.1.

    הבא, בואו לפתוח את הקובץ MySQL config כדי לראות מה מופיע שם.

    sudo nano /etc/mysql/my.cnf

    גלול מטה עד שתראה שורה המתחילה ב"כתובת איגום "כמו למטה.

    כפי שאתם רואים, כתובת האיגום זהה, אז אנחנו טובים. אם שלך שונה, פשוט לשנות את זה כך שהוא תואם את מה שמצאתי לעיל.

    מתקין את phpMyAdmin

    אם אתה לא מכיר את MySQL ואת הפקודות שלה, אז ייתכן שיהיה קצת בעיות בניהול מסדי נתונים וטבלאות. phpMyAdmin עוזר לך להתמודד עם זה על ידי מתן ממשק PHP לניהול MySQL. זה קל להתקנה והוא באמת יכול לבוא שימושי, אז בואו להגיע אליו.

    sudo apt-get להתקין phpmyadmin

    אם פקודה זו אינה פועלת, ייתכן שיהיה עליך להפעיל מאגרים נוספים.

    תקבל עוד מסך כחול לבוא לשאול אותך לבחור איזה שרת אינטרנט להגדיר. ודא את הבלוק האדום הוא ליד "apache2" ולהיות בטוח להכות את מקש הרווח. זה יסמן את זה עם כוכבית, ואז אתה יכול ללחוץ על Enter.

    תישאל אם phpmyadmin צריך להגדיר מסד נתונים ברירת מחדל לשימוש משלו. בחר כן.

    לאחר מכן, תתבקש להזין את הסיסמה של חשבון הניהול המשמש ליצירת מסד נתונים זה ומשתמש זה. מכיוון שלא יצרנו משתמשים אחרים ב- MySQL, הזן את סיסמת השורש של MySQL.

    לבסוף, תיצור סיסמה לשימוש עם phpmyadmin, ויהיה עליך לאשר אותה שוב.

    לאחר שתסיים, הפעל מחדש את אפאצ 'י.

    ניתן להיכנס ל- phpMyAdmin על ידי מעבר לכתובת הבאה:

    http: // localhost / phpmyadmin /

    השתמש "שורש" כמו שם המשתמש ולאחר מכן להזין את הסיסמה MySQL השורש.


    יש כאן יותר מכמה סיסמאות חשובות, ותתפתה להשתמש באותה סיסמה כמו חשבון הבסיס שלך. אם תבחר לעשות זאת, ודא כי היא סיסמה מאובטחת מאוד, משהו עם כיתות אופי מעורב אורך טוב. זכור, אתה נותן לאחרים גישה למחשב שלך על ידי התקנת תוכנה זו, אז לנקוט אמצעי זהירות מתאימים.

    אם זו הפעם הראשונה שאתה משחק עם שרת אינטרנט, ייתכן שאתה תוהה היכן הקבצים שאתה רוצה לארח ללכת. הם נמצאים / var / www / להיות ברירת המחדל, ויהיה צורך הרשאות גבוהות לגשת לספרייה זו. רעיון אחד הוא לעלות מחיצה נפרדת לנקודה זו כדי לשמש אך ורק לשרת דברים באינטרנט. בדוק את המאמר השני שלנו, מה זה fstab לינוקס איך זה עובד ?, כדי לקבל קצת מידע נוסף על כך.

    ו, עכשיו שיש לך שרת אינטרנט משלך, למה לא ללמוד כיצד ארכיון, חיפוש, ולהציג שלך לסטטיסטיקה לסטות עם ThinkUp?